About Hartley, CA
Hartley is a small community in California with a population of 1,966 residents. The median household income is $120,354 per year, which is above the national average. The median age in Hartley is 54.9 years.
Housing in Hartley has a median home value of $864,100 and median monthly rent of $1,115. Of the 1,017 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 619 owner-occupied and 272 renter-occupied units.
The unemployment rate in Hartley is 0.1% and the poverty rate is 7.5%. 24.0%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 31.6 minutes.

Cost of Living in Hartley, CA
Compared to national averages, Hartley has a median household income of $120,354 (60% above the national median of $75,149). Home values average $864,100, which is 253% above the national median. Monthly rent at $1,115 is 4% below the US average of $1,163. Within California, Hartley's income is 23% above the state average of $97,829, and home values are 32% above the state median of $653,874.
